- ShahriduanOct 18, 2024 · 9 months agoThe current regulatory environment for cryptocurrencies in South Korea is quite strict. The government has implemented several laws and regulations to ensure the safety and security of cryptocurrency transactions. The Financial Services Commission (FSC) is the main regulatory body responsible for overseeing the cryptocurrency market in South Korea. They have introduced measures such as the real-name system, which requires cryptocurrency exchanges to verify the identity of their users. Additionally, exchanges are required to comply with anti-money laundering (AML) and know your customer (KYC) regulations. These regulations aim to prevent illegal activities such as money laundering and terrorist financing. Overall, the regulatory environment in South Korea is aimed at promoting transparency and protecting investors.
- ASKFeb 11, 2023 · 2 years agoThe regulatory environment for cryptocurrencies in South Korea is constantly evolving. The government has recognized the potential of cryptocurrencies and blockchain technology, but also acknowledges the risks associated with them. As a result, they have taken a cautious approach to regulation. The South Korean government has banned initial coin offerings (ICOs) and imposed restrictions on cryptocurrency trading. However, they have also expressed interest in creating a legal framework for cryptocurrencies and have been exploring the possibility of introducing a digital currency backed by the central bank. It is important for investors and users of cryptocurrencies in South Korea to stay updated on the latest regulations and comply with them to avoid any legal issues.
